EI-chip high-speed punch punching mold design of the nesting
Punching nesting is an important part of high-speed presses mold design, layout can not determine out punching, but also determines the material utilization and high-speed productivity.
Non-standard EI punching is the hub of the system of non-standard EI sheet, a sheet corresponding to an I-slice E, the more common nesting as shown, the material utilization rate is only 74 percent for large-scale production, material utilization slight increase , the economic benefits is very significant, and therefore improve material utilization as possible. Then there is no material utilization higher than this row like it, a careful analysis of EI sheet drawings, plus or minus about the size of a mobile combination arrangement, the two E sheet offset, as shown in nesting, material utilization rate of 85%. When comparing the two, improve material utilization * 1:20 * 2- nesting program and a 11 percent die in the size, shape and number of punch, difficult process and other aspects of essentially the same, that is to say the development cost of the mold no increase, while hedge sheet manufacturers, the economic benefits have been significantly by improved.
In the layout design, but also consider facilitating the punching leads. Imagine, four hundred times per minute speed punch, a four-piece mold (EI tablets each two pieces) If you can not successfully lead, out of all the sheets, by manual sorting, you simply can not do a one person on duty high-speed presses (operating presses, feeding, punching packing a person all inclusive) and therefore must lead by punching rack smoothly leads.
